Organic Amnesia
A form of amnesia caused by brain injury or damage affecting memory, not linked to psychological factors.
Dissociative Fugue
A rare psychiatric disorder characterized by reversible amnesia for personal identity, including the memories, personality, and other identifying characteristics of individuality.
Psychoanalytic Theory
A set of theories originating from Sigmund Freud, which suggest that human behavior is profoundly influenced by unconscious motives.
Conversion Disorder
A mental condition where psychological stress is expressed through physical symptoms that have no medical basis.
